企业级语音聊天系统项目实施方案与分阶段部署策略

首页 / 产品中心 / 企业级语音聊天系统项目实施方案与分阶段部

企业级语音聊天系统项目实施方案与分阶段部署策略

📅 2026-05-09 🔖 聊天室,语音聊天

在实时互动场景日益复杂的今天,企业级语音聊天系统的稳定性与延迟控制,直接决定了用户的留存率。以聊聊语音聊天网为例,我们面对的不只是简单的点对点通话,而是成千上万人同时涌入的聊天室高并发场景。如何在有限的带宽与服务器资源下,实现毫秒级的语音同步,这需要一套严谨的分阶段部署策略。

底层架构:从信令到媒体流的全链路优化

语音聊天的核心技术难点在于**信令交互**与**媒体流传输**的解耦。我们采用WebRTC作为底层协议,但直接裸用显然无法承载企业级负载。在项目初期,我们通过部署**独立的信令服务器集群**,将用户登录、房间管理、路由协商等逻辑与媒体流分离。实测数据显示,这种架构让单台服务器的并发连接数提升了约40%,因为信令包体积小,可以走长连接复用,而媒体流则通过独立的UDP端口直连,减少了TCP的拥塞控制开销。

分阶段部署:先跑通核心,再优化边缘

我们把整个实施过程拆解为三个阶段,每个阶段都设定了明确的性能指标:

  • 第一阶段(基础构建):搭建最小可用集群,支持500人同时在线聊天室。此时重点验证媒体流的丢包重传机制,目标丢包率低于2%。
  • 第二阶段(弹性扩容):引入Kubernetes实现动态扩缩容。当聊天室人数超过1000时,自动拉起新的媒体转发节点(SFU),避免单点瓶颈。
  • 第三阶段(边缘节点部署):在全球主要区域部署边缘转发服务器,将用户到最近节点的延迟控制在50ms以内。
  • 实操方法:动态码率与智能降噪的协同

    在具体的语音聊天场景中,网络波动是常态。我们采用**自适应码率算法**:当检测到丢包率上升时,系统自动将音频编码从Opus的128kbps降至64kbps,同时开启前向纠错(FEC)。对比传统固定码率方案,这种动态调节让通话中断率下降了约35%。此外,针对聊天室中常见的多人同时发言导致的回声问题,我们在客户端集成了AI降噪模块,实测能将背景噪声抑制到-45dB以下,而CPU占用仅增加5%。

    从数据对比来看,采用分阶段部署策略后,聊聊语音聊天网的全链路平均延迟从最初的180ms降至85ms,而用户投诉率下降了62%。

    数据驱动:用真实场景验证部署效果

    我们做过一个A/B测试:A组使用传统单点架构,B组使用本文所述的分阶段方案。在2000人同时语音聊天的高峰期,A组的抖动缓冲区频繁溢出,导致声音断续;B组则通过边缘节点的智能路由,将媒体流分散到不同节点,抖动几乎可以忽略。这证明了**分散式部署**对语音聊天体验的提升是质变的。当然,一切优化都需要配合完善的监控告警,我们使用Prometheus采集每个节点的实时延迟和丢包率,一旦阈值超标,自动触发扩容或切换节点。

    企业级语音聊天系统的落地,从来不是一蹴而就的。从信令的轻量化处理,到媒体流的边缘化分发,再到AI算法的实时介入,每一步都需要反复压测与调参。只有坚持分阶段推进,才能让聊天室的每一次语音互动都流畅如面谈。

相关推荐

📄

高品质语音聊天室音频质量管控的关键技术要点解析

2026-05-03

📄

语音聊天室常见网络延迟故障诊断与排查指南

2026-05-13

📄

2025年语音聊天行业数据安全政策解读与合规建议

2026-06-05

📄

如何评估语音聊天室服务的稳定性与可用性

2026-04-30